Okie Ramen Bowl

DESCRIPTION :
THE PERFECT MIXTURE OF ASIAN FLAVORS AND OKLAHOMA INGREDIENTS COMBINE FOR A WARMING RAMEN BOWL / SERVES 4
INGREDIENTS
1 ( 1-pound ) Oklahoma pork tenderloin 1 tablespoon Head Country All-Purpose Championship Seasoning ½ cup Head Country Bar-B-Q Sauce 6 cups chicken broth 3 stalks bok choy 1 to 2 tablespoons soy sauce 1 ( 8-ounce ) package J-M Mushrooms 1 tablespoon grated fresh ginger 1 small package thin rice noodles Lime wedges , thinly sliced ¼ cup Scissortail Farm cilantro leaves , chopped ¼ cup Scissortail Farms chives , chopped Chopped dry-roasted peanuts ½ pound Bar-S Bacon , cooked and crumbled
DIRECTIONS
1 . Combine Head Country seasoning and sauce in a shallow bowl . Cover and marinate at least 1 hour in the refrigerator .
2 . Preheat oven to 350 degrees . Roast pork in a shallow baking dish for about 30 minutes or until internal temperature reaches 160 degrees . Remove from oven , then let rest 10 minutes before slicing very thin .
3 . In a large saucepan , bring the chicken broth to a boil . Turn heat down to simmer . Add bok choy , cooking for 3-5 minutes or until blanched .
4 . Add soy sauce , mushrooms , ginger and noodles , simmering 5 minutes or until the noodles are done .
5 . To assemble , pour noodles and broth into bowls . Add mushrooms and bok choy , if desired . Place sliced pork on top , followed by lime wedges , cilantro , chives , peanuts and bacon .
